Computer-Aided Diagnosis of Mammograms is a developing research area. The use of a computer system as a second reader for the Radiologists is appealing as a means of increasing diagnosis accuracy. Multiple steps are present in Computer-Aided Diagnosis systems, including a segmentation of the breast from the rest of the mammogram.
520
$a
A fully automated method for a true border mammogram segmentation is detailed. The method makes use of Active Contours or "Snakes" as a means of locating the true border. A new derivation of Active Contour, which uses a neural network and is hence dubbed the Neural Snake, is researched and created. Both Snakes are tested, and their behaviour is compared. Future work on Neural Snakes is detailed.
